Easy Peanut Butter Cookies
1 cup creamy peanut butter
1 cup granulated sugar or brown sugar
1 egg
1 tsp. baking soda
1/3 cup chocolate chips
Sea Salt (optional)
Mix the peanut butter, sugar, and egg together. Add baking soda. Stir in chocolate chips.
Use spoon to scoop the dough and roll in 1 inch balls and place them on a cookie sheet with parchment paper.
Bake at 350 for 8 minutes.

When they come out of the oven I sprinkle a little sea salt on the top of the cookie.
